 CCMplanet » your christian music source
To promote the album, Jody Davis will perform late-night solo concerts at AtlantaFest, Alive Festival, Creation East, and other major summer events where Newsboys are a headlining act.
2001-02-12 - Following the success of bass player Phil Joel's Watching Over You project, another Newsboys member, guitarist Jody Davis, is preparing to release his debut solo album while maintaining complete allegiance to his blockbuster band's everyday schedule.
Davis' self-titled set from Pamplin Records will hit stores on March 27 and is expected to turn some heads.

 Jesusfreakhideout.com: Phil Joel, "Bring It On" Review
The CD was warmly accepted by Newsboys and already Phil fans alike and produced the hit single "God Is Watching Over You." A sophomore solo project was inevitable and Fall 2002 sees the release of Bring It On.
Joel seems to be more about having fun through his music this time around, a personality trait obvious during his work with the Newsboys.
Phil Joel takes the opportunity to experiment more with his sound on Bring It On occasionally missing the mark, but for the most part succeeds in producing a fun and lyrically encouraging pop rock album.
